Transaction 21fed6f123a566bd62e35b89d4bb30c73527562b7011d9e9ea409f85910e2151
1 Input
1 Output
-
21fed6f123a566bd62e35b89d4bb30c73527562b7011d9e9ea409f85910e2151:0
- value
- 1922504
- script pubkey
- OP_0 OP_PUSHBYTES_20 617b335770e83cb6554eb357b2c2298887166044
- address
- bc1qv9anx4msaq7tv42wkdtm9s3f3zr3vczytjrvhn